Abstract
本发明提供一种叠层式电池组、超级电容组隔膜涂胶机,包括驱动电机,驱动电机带动上浆辊,上浆辊通过带轮带动胶辊,上浆辊下设有上胶槽,在上浆辊和胶辊一边设有放纸平台,另一边设有收料平板,上浆辊和胶辊的切线对应放纸平台平面;其中放纸平台平面与上浆辊和胶辊之间还设有送纸轮。本发明利用上浆辊和胶辊对层叠式超级电容器隔膜进行印刷热熔胶,上浆辊和胶辊的切线对应放纸平台平面,是为了隔膜的平整、完整,具有涂覆均匀、平整、速度快等优点,实现超级电容器的批量化生产,印刷后的隔膜光滑、无气孔、裂纹和花纹等现象,印刷时纸张无皱折,多快好省地解决了隔膜绝缘的问题。
Description
一种叠层式电池组或超级电容组的隔膜涂胶机
技术领域
[0001] 本发明涉及一种印刷设备,尤其涉及一种叠层式电池组或超级电容组的隔膜涂胶 机,主要用于在储能电子元器件隔膜材料四周边缘上印刷热熔胶,用于储能元件单元与单 元之间绝缘封堵。
背景技术
[0002] 由于叠层式超级电容组、电池组是由多个储能单元串联而成,单元与单元之间必 须绝缘。由于两电极之间的距离很小,在制造过程中很容易造成两电极之间的短路,这样轻 者会影响电容器的寿命,重者会损坏电容器,更严重的会发生安全事故,因此叠层式超级电 容组、电池组电极之间的绝缘是该类型储能元件制作的重点,也是难点,以前为了解决这方 面的问题,我们采取了贴胶带、预埋绝缘框、集中喷胶等方法,这样效果虽然很好,但是工效 很低,无法实现超级电容器的批量化生产。
发明内容
[0003] 本发明的叠层式电池组或者超级电容组的隔膜涂胶机主要是在隔膜纸四周边缘 印刷热熔胶,用于叠层式电池组或超级电容组的隔膜材料的前期处理。
[0004] 为此本发明的技术方案为,一种叠层式电池组或超级电容组的隔膜涂胶机,包括 驱动电机,驱动电机带动上浆辊,上浆辊通过带轮带动胶辊,上浆辊下设有上胶槽,在上浆 辊和胶辊一边设有放纸平台,另一边设有收料平板,其特征在于:上浆辊和胶辊的切线对应 放纸平台平面;其中放纸平台平面与上浆辊和胶辊之间还设有送纸轮。
[0005] 进一步的改进在于:放纸平台下设有两个刮刀,刮刀分为一上一下两个对应在上 浆辊的侧边。
[0006] 进一步的改进在于:收料平板上还设有悬浮气流装置。
[0007] 进一步的改进在于:在胶辊的上方还设有调节装置。
[0008] 进一步的改进在于:上胶槽通过连接阀连接有胶池。
[0009] 进一步的改进在于:收料平板向下倾斜于水平线。
[0010] 进一步的改进在于:在收料平板下设有收料槽。
[0011] 有益效果:
[0012]本发明利用上浆辊和胶辊对叠层式电池组或者超级电容组的隔膜进行印刷热熔 胶,上浆辊和胶辊的切线对应放纸平台平面,是为了隔膜的平整、完整,具有涂覆均匀、平 整、速度快等优点,实现超级电容器的批量化生产,印刷后的隔膜光滑、无气孔、裂纹和花纹 等现象,印刷时纸张无皱折,多快好省地解决了隔膜绝缘的问题。
[0013] 两个刮刀的使用,主要是对热熔胶的涂覆均匀设置的。
[0014] 悬浮气流装置保证了印刷后的隔膜能够快速晾干、固化。
[0015] 调节装置的设置可以调节印刷的厚度。
[0016] 连接阀连接胶池可以控制上胶槽内胶料的多少。
[0017] 收料平板向下倾斜于水平线方便印刷后的隔膜能够有一个重力下降的过程。
[0018] 收料槽将通过收料平板的隔膜收集。

具体实施方式
[0021] 本发明如图1所示。
[0022] 叠层式电池组或超级电容组的隔膜涂胶机,包括驱动电机1,驱动电机1带动上浆 辊2,上浆辊2通过带轮4带动胶辊3,上浆辊2下设有上胶槽5,在上浆辊2和胶辊3—边设有放 纸平台6,另一边设有收料平板11,上浆辊2和胶辊3的切线对应放纸平台平面6;其中放纸平 台6平面与上浆辊2和胶辊3之间还设有送纸轮7。
[0023] 放纸平台6下设有两个刮刀8,刮刀8分为一上一下两个对应在上浆辊2的侧边。 [0024] 收料平板11上还设有悬浮气流装置9。
[0025] 在胶辊3的上方还设有调节装置10。
[0026]上胶槽5通过连接阀12连接有胶池14。
[0027] 收料平板11向下倾斜于水平线。
[0028]在收料平板11下设有收料槽13。
[0029] 本发明根据不同应用要求采取的不同的热熔胶、不同的温度、涂胶速度控制策略, 例如:无机系超级电容、镍氢电池组纸质隔膜涂胶速度30m/min,热熔胶熔点160°,凝固温度 130°;锂电池组PE、PE/PP/PE复合等类似基材涂胶速度20m/min,热熔胶熔点120°,凝固温度 90°以免破坏基材本身。
[0030] 本隔膜涂胶机能每分钟印刷1000多张,是手工贴胶带的一千多倍,而且印刷质量 平整、光滑、无空洞、裂纹和花纹等现象,印刷时纸张无皱折,多快好省地解决了隔膜绝缘的 问题,为超级电容器批量化生产创造了条件。
